Mahabharata Vana Parva – यदि परशमम इच्छेयुः कुरवः पाण्डवैः सह

Shloka (श्लोक)

यदि परशमम इच्छेयुः कुरवः पाण्डवैः सह
तथापि युद्धं दाशार्ह यॊजयेथाः सहैव तैः

⚡ Quick Meaning

This suggests that even if peace is desired, the inevitability of war remains when necessary.

Translations

English Translation

Even if the Kauravas together wish for peace alongside the Pandavas, they must still engage in battle, highlighting the unavoidable nature of conflict in certain situations.

हिंदी अनुवाद

यदि कुरव और पाण्डव एक साथ शांति की इच्छा करें, तब भी उन्हें युद्ध में शामिल होना पड़ेगा, यह दर्शाते हुए कि कुछ स्थितियों में संघर्ष अनिवार्य होता है।

Commentary

Context

This verse reflects the tragic inevitability of war in the Mahabharata narrative, despite aspirations for peace.

Meaning

The shloka conveys the idea that sometimes, despite desires for harmony, circumstances force confrontation.

Application

This can be applied to situations in life where peace talks may lead to unavoidable conflicts, suggesting preparation for possible outcomes.
